Transaction 0b17594d3a101a60f0d2315eefada89a1b9e609f81670c16112be4559664bdbe
1 Input
1 Output
-
0b17594d3a101a60f0d2315eefada89a1b9e609f81670c16112be4559664bdbe:0
- value
- 1182815
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e9bf626edaf2164818b3a4d55329a791b67702aa OP_EQUAL
- address
- 3NzxdsLaBqe7AsGN8p7aRCeg4bBJ7dQ4Se